Transaction 60685c333fc2660174683999e2b8ffac516eae77381d3806a9e108884f14bb14
1 Input
1 Output
-
60685c333fc2660174683999e2b8ffac516eae77381d3806a9e108884f14bb14:0
- value
- 1006317
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e74bfccefdb00b39520ed71c002a4861b3a5c34
- address
- bc1q8e6tln80mvqt89fqa4cuqq4yscdn5hp5lr9rk0